{ int a,b; a= 0; b= 0; scanf("%d%d",&a,&b);//输入两个数 a , b. int temp;//创建中间变量 temp=a;//利用中间变量 temp保存 a 的值 (a的初始值) a=b;//把 b 的值赋给 a b= temp;//再把 temp(a的初始值)的值赋给 b printf("%d %d",a,b);//打印a,b,实现 a b...
广告 从键盘输入两个数字字符并分别存放在字符型变量a,b中,通过程... #include <stdio.h> void main(){ char a,b; int result; printf("输入两个字符:\n"); scanf("%c\n%c",&a,&b); result=a-'0'+b-'0'... 编写程序:编写程序,从键盘输入两个数字字符,并分别存放在字符... main(){ ch...
输入两个整数a和b输出a、b交换后的值。注意:两个数之间有1个空格,输出后换行。样例输入
// 交换两个整数并输出 int temp = a; a = b; b = temp; cout << "交换后,它们的值分别是:" << a << " 和 " << b << endl; 本题要求编写一个程序,先输入两个整数,求它们的和,然后交换这两个整数并输出。这道题目需要用到两个变量,一个用来存储第一个输入的整数,另一个用来存储第二个...
一:使用中间变量 include <stdio.h> int main() { int a, b;printf("请输入两个整数a和b,以空格隔开:");scanf("%d %d", &a, &b);printf("交换前:a = %d,b = %d\n", a, b);int temp = a;a = b;b = temp;printf("交换后:a = %d,b = %d\n", a, b);return...
编写一个程序,要求输入两个数a、b的值,输出a+b和ab的值.【解析】 (1)输入语句要求输入的值只能是具体的常数,不能是变量或表达式(输入语句无计算功能).若输入多个数,各数之间应用逗号“,”隔开.(2)计算机执行到输入语句时,等候用户输入“提示内容”所提示的数据,输入后回车,则程序继续运行,“提示内容”及其后...
编写一个交换两个变量A和B的值的程序. INPUT A,B PRINT A,B A=B B=A PRINT A,B END 相关知识点: 试题来源: 解析 解:程序如下: INPUT-|||-A,B-|||-PRINT-|||-A,B-|||-X=A-|||-A=B-|||-B=X-|||-PRINT-|||-A,B-|||-END ...
int main(int argc, char *argv[]) //主函数,字符的声明 { char a,b; //定义字符a,b scanf("%c %c",&a,&b); //输入字符a,b printf("%c %c\n",a,b);//打印字符a,b return 0; //返回并且输出a,b } 扩展知识:Matlab变量的特点:不需事先声明,也不需指定变量...
【程序实现】 # 用户输入 x = input ( ' 输入 x 值 : ' ) y = input ( ' 输入 y 值 : ' ) # 不使用临时变量 x , y = y , x print ( ' 交换后 x 的值为 : {}' . format ( x )) print ( ' 交换后 y 的值为 : {}' . format ( y )) 【程序结果】 输入 x 值 : 3 输...
分析: 若想交换两个变量x,y的值,第一步,把x的值赋给T,即T=x.第二步,把y的值赋给x,即x=y,第三步,把T的值赋给y,即y=T.设计流程图算法. 解答: 解: INPUT a,b PRINT a,b c=a a=b b=c PRINT a,b END 点评: 本题考查顺序结构,解题时要认真审题,仔细解答,注意交换两个变量的值的算法....